Question:
this regulator has 2 inlet 1/4inch can i remove the 1/4inch and use the 3/8 my connect hose from tank to regulator has a 3/8 fitting i was just wondering if this would harm anything. thank you
asked by: Bob C
Expert Reply:
I went out to the warehouse and took a look at regulator # CAM59005. I don't think using a 3/8 hose fitting will work. If that inlet fitting is removed the hole diameter is right about 1/2 inch. Though it could be that the outer diameter of your hose fitting is around 1/2 inch in which case it would work. To remove all doubt I recommend hose # CAM59065.
